I'm only guesstimating his age 7 weeks back from when I received him because he was much smaller then but he's a little over 4 months old and just weighed him yesterday at the vet for 3 pounds and 11 ounces. Face is pretty roundish I think and I measured his ears at 4 inches.
 
I think you may have to wait a little longer to know for sure if he is a Holland or a Mini...Hollands are generally 3-4 pounds and minis are usually 4-6 pounds! Weight may not be the best indicator of breed in this instance. Harlequin is a very underdeveloped color in the lop breeds, so the type on them is typically (though not always) very poor. That doesn't effect their temperament or personality at all and any bunny can certainly be a wonderful pet! It just means that the rabbit may not exhibit characteristics close to the recognized breed standard. A harlie/tri Holland, for instance, will typically be longer in body, face and ear than a show Holland. Likewise, they may be larger or more "broody" overall.

Based on the look of the rabbit in the pictures, my guess would be Holland lineage more than Mini Lop. But without seeing the parents or having a pedigree in hand, it would be tough to be sure on this color.
